 Summary

The arthor argues that in a writing we add some complex turn of phrase,
metaphors to show details, But you can actually write in a way that reward your reader
and his most of learning needs. It can be anything a big report or an email to your
colleagues. The five tactics you are going to keep in mind that will help you deliver your
message:

1) Keep it Simple
2) Keep it Specific
3) Keep it Stirring
4) Keep it Social
5) Keep it story-driven
